The game was published on June 2013 in Japan by Koei Tecmo, to great success. The story takes place in Utakata Village, one of the final lines of defense against the demons. Eight years prior to the commencement of the story, a calamity known as the Awakening opened a massive gateway to the Underworld and brought an era of destruction as the Oni hordes ravaged the land and its people, forcing the mononofu to step out of the shadows and take charge of the fragmented remains of society. Throughout history, warriors known as mononofu, or "Slayers", have been protecting Nakatsu Kuni from malevolent beings from the Underworld known as Oni in secret.
